I have not used my Everest 2X camping yet but did test it out as soon as I received it. I filled a two qt. sauce pan with 1 1/2 quarts of cold tap water( at sea level) and fired it up. On full high the water boiled in 3 minutes 50 seconds, much faster than kitchen range. Amazing high heat and it sounds like a jet engine. It also simmers at very low heat( wind was moderate) without any trouble. My only issue, which seems to have self- resolved, was one of the burner's igniter did not spark. After turning the igniter knob 5- 10 times in succession it began to spark intermittently and then it worked consistently. I 've only used the stove once for this test before taking it into the field so I 'll have to see if it continues to ignite properly. I purchased the 2' extension hose and 1lb. canister stand for convenience and canister placement options. Bothe that hose and the included hard pipe connector worked perfectly and I did not experience any leakage( as some reported with the hard pipe) on either connector. Ca n't wait to cook some meals while camping. The Everest 2X seems to be a very well made unit and is capable of crazy high temps and cooking speed if necessary. Highly recommended.

Frequently Asked Questions For High Pressure Burner

A high pressure burner is a device designed to produce a concentrated flame by mixing fuel with air at high pressure. This type of burner is commonly used in various applications, including industrial heating, cooking, and outdoor grilling. The high pressure allows for efficient combustion and can generate higher temperatures compared to standard burners.

High pressure burners are versatile and can be used in several applications, including commercial kitchens, outdoor cooking, and industrial processes. They are ideal for tasks that require high heat output, such as frying, boiling, or even metalworking. Their ability to produce intense heat makes them suitable for both professional and recreational use.

High pressure burners are usually constructed from durable materials that can withstand high temperatures and pressures, such as stainless steel or cast iron. These materials ensure longevity and resistance to corrosion, making them suitable for outdoor and industrial environments. The choice of material can also affect the burner's efficiency and heat distribution.

When selecting a high pressure burner, consider factors such as the intended use, required heat output, and fuel type. It's important to assess the size and design of the burner to ensure it fits your cooking or heating setup. Additionally, look for features like adjustable flame control and safety mechanisms to enhance usability.

Safety is crucial when using high pressure burners due to the intense heat and potential risks involved. Always operate the burner in a well-ventilated area and keep flammable materials away from the flame. It's also advisable to use protective gear and to familiarize yourself with the burner's operation manual to ensure safe usage.

Yes, high pressure burners are excellent for outdoor cooking, especially for tasks that require high heat, such as boiling large pots of water or frying. They are often used for outdoor events like camping, tailgating, or backyard gatherings. Ensure that the burner is stable and placed on a non-flammable surface for safe outdoor use.
